Hello. I am new to this forum. I do a bit of work with custom mitsubishi's. At present I am doing the measurements on CH Lancer VR-X trailing arms. These may fit the rear of the FTO. What this means is that the brakes from the Evo 9 will probably then be a bolt on option for the FTO.(FTO stud pattern would not change). I will update when I know for sure.  |

| I got hold of a full set of evo 9 brakes off a car that was totalled. I tried them on my wife's CH lancer vr-x, and they fit perfectly over the handbrake & everything. Have to modify the backing plate of course. What I was looking for is an easy way to fit massive brakes all round on FTO's without having to fabricate parts. You can buy heaps of evo 9 stuff, and it would be good to know they can be fitted to other mitsubishis without too much trouble. |

| I have had the CE Lancer, CH Lancer and FTO rear trailing arms lying side by side and they all seem to mount the same. I know for sure the FTO trailing arms fit the CE lancer straight up. Handbrake cables fit easy as well. |
